Mayor and Council – Just a few thoughts on this issue for all of you:
There are currently 5,578 Registered Voters in Molalla. Jason Griswold and two other people were able to obtain 678 valid signatures of those voters to have the Street Utility put on the ballot. There are many more voters who either declined to sign or were not contacted. Some people who signed may not fully understand what they were signing and some actually did know. I believe we have an opportunity to get the accurate word out over the next couple of months.
At a Staff level we are working on a “neutral” ballot explanation. It may be a good time to think about what information you need and who you want out there helping spread the word.
